I am wondering if it is possible to generate 2 waveforms with a phase lag with the NI myDAQ. From my experience, it seems like myDAQ is not able to give both outputs simultaneously.

According to the NI myDAQ user manual, which is linked below, both analog output channels have a dedicated digital-to-analog converter (DAC), so they can update simultaneously. This would mean that you should be able to generate 2 waveform with a phase lag.
